S

Sheila Krynski

1 year ago

Crush10media, inc. 💯 Their team is knowledgeable a...

Crush10media, inc. 💯 Their team is knowledgeable and dedicated. They have helped me grow my business online and I couldn't be happier with the results!

Comments:

No comments